Nathan Lockman of Murdock, a former Elmwood Murdock graduate, was accepted into the UNL Center for Entrepreneurship’s Nebraska Entrepreneurship Accelerator program. The program supports entrepreneurs across multiple stages of business development to help students prepare to operate their own businesses. Nathan is a senior studying PGA golf management and founder of The Birdie Shot.

Elmwood Village Board Meetings are ONCE a month on the FIRST Wednesday of every month.
The meetings are held at the new Village Board office located at the Learning Center on the south side of town.
Official agendas are posted the day before at the Post Office, Gas Station, and Village Office. Prior to the posting of the agenda, meeting items can be added to the meeting. At the end of each meeting is a Public Comment Section. Attendees have three minutes to speak about anything at this time. Further discussion on the topic can then be added to the next board meeting.
The agenda is posted at the Elmwood C-Store, the post office, and the Village office.
Minutes can be viewed at the Village office or can be found online.

Manley, Neb. - The Lofte Community Theatre will open Rumors on October 17th, 2025. The show will run through October 26th, with performances Thursday through Sunday. Thursday, Friday, and Saturday performances start at 7 PM and Sunday performances start at 2 PM. The concession stand and house will open one hour before performance start times. Tickets are on sale now and can be purchased by calling the Lofte Box Office, by phone at 402-234-2553, or by visiting www.lofte.org.
Synopsis: A wedding anniversary party is being held for Charley Brock, the Deputy Mayor of New York, and his wife, Myra. Ken Gorman, a lawyer, and his wife, Chris, are the first to arrive at the party and first to discover Charley with a flesh wound, who now lies bleeding in another room. Myra is nowhere to be seen. Charley’s self-inflicted bullet injury sets off a series of events, causing his guests to scramble to get “the story” straight before the authorities arrive. As the confusion and miscommunications mount, the evening spins off into classic farcical hilarity. We suggest PG-13.
Directed By: Kevin Colbert
About The Lofte Community Theatre: The Lofte Community Theatre is located in Manley Nebraska, approximately 25 minutes south of Omaha. The theatre, a new post-and-beam style performing arts facility can seat approximately 330 patrons for each performance. Actors and audience members enjoy a beautiful climate-controlled venue year-round with concessions offered.
